Tho Amorican barkontinn Inn
gar d, Schmidt master, arrived iu
port at about 6:30 o'clock last
evening, 15 days from San Fran
cisco, with a cargo1 of 1200 tons of
gonoral merchandise consigned to
P A Sohaefor & Co. Tho Inn
gard brought 17 horsos, 20 mulos
nnd 250 hogs, tho last for Ed
Wagner.
Tho Japaneso stonmor Kinoura
Maru, Shina master, anchored off
port at 10 o'clock last night and
came in to an anchorage in the
stream at daybreak. Sho has
aboard CSC Japanese in tho steer
ago and Gvo in tho cabin for this
port. Her freight consists of 80S
tons of general morchandiso con
signed to T H Davies & Co.

Two WrlU uT Mitmtiimiu St'rtvit n
Ciilloit.ir :riirnl .lliSlockvr.
An altornativo writ of manda
iiius has boon servod nu Collector
General P. IJ. McStocker, at tho
instonco of George V. Mocforlane,
to compol him to procoed to tho
registration of tho bark Williscott,
for which petitioner has received
a temporary Hawaiian register
from Ouas. T. Wildor, Hawaiiau
Consul Genoral at San Prancisco.
Tho writ ia mado returnablo on
Tuesday at 10 a. m , beforo Circuit
Judgo Perry.
A similar writ has boon sorved
on tho Collector General, on tho
petition of Lincoln 1). Sponcor, to
procure a register for tho bark Eu
torpo, which has boen granted a
tomporary Hawaiian rogistor by
J. U. Carter, Hawaiian Consul at
Seattle.
